Russian forces intensify bombardment of Ukraine, as invasion enters 7th day, and claim control of Kherson, the nation’s 3rd largest city-Ukraine denies that claim.
United Nations overwhelmingly urge Russia to stop its invasion of Ukraine.
Republicans urge Biden administration to sanction Russia’s oil and gas revenues and beef up oil production at home.
World Health Organization reports hospitals in Ukraine under siege, calls for halt on firing at medical facilities.
International Criminal Court launches investiation into Russian war crimes, genocide or crimes against humanity in Ukraine.
Texas primary results are in: Democrat Beto O’Rourke will challenge Republican Governor Greg Abbott for his seat.
Santa Clara County drops it’s indoor mask mandate, becomes last Bay Area county to do so.
Snow Survey in Sierra Nevada indicates another drought year ahead.
